    Lake Havasu Classic Logo.jpg Lake Havasu Classic Outboard Championships
    October 15-17, 2021
    The NGK Spark Plugs Formula 1 Powerboat Championship series would like to formally invite each one of you to join us in beautiful Lake Havasu City, Arizona to celebrate the legendary London Bridges 50th anniversary. We plan to relive the glory days of powerboat racing while once again dazzling the shores of this desert city with the running of the beloved Lake Havasu Classic Outboard Championships! In conjunction with the month-long city-wide celebration, a variety of activities to commemorate this historical milestone will culminate with the heart-thumping, high-horsepower deck to deck racing excitement of the Lake Havasu Classic Outboard Championships on October 15-17, 2021 as the celebrations anchor event.

    Other elements of this event will include rededication of the city’s famous London Bridge, historical museum display, beach party, vintage boat display, and the Lake Havasu Classic Racer Reunion – which will showcase Lake Havasu’s legendary drivers alongside vintage racing boats – to give contestants and spectators alike the opportunity to appreciate our sport, both in years past, and present. Race headquarters and free “front and center” racetrack spectating areas that allow fans access to the best racecourse viewing at the Nautical Beachfront Resort, 1000 McCullough Blvd. N, overlooking Thompson Bay – which long-time powerboat participants and fans will remember as the original championship event location dating back to 1964. We intend to reignite a spark of powerboat history in this long-forgotten arena and foster new growth for our sport.

    Event Activities:

    Formula 1 Powerboat Racing presented by Anderson Toyota- The prestigious NGK Spark Plugs Formula 1 Powerboat Championship Series–known for its world class powerboat racing action–will be conducting all the powerboat racing related activities. The action-packed outboard racing held at the historic Nautical Beachfront Resort venue will entertain fans with three classes of fierce powerboat competition! This APBA sanctioned event with participating teams vying for the APBA North American Championships in both the Formula 1 and Tri Hull divisions while the APBA Western Divisional Championships will be hotly contested in the Formula Lights division.

    Lake Havasu Classic Racers Reunion presented by Mercury Racing hosted by Bill Seebold- Many Havasu Classic stars from the past will be in attendance to revel in the excitement of this highly anticipated racing event. Our powerboat racing royalty will be treated to a special VIP viewing area for on-water racing activities, a special reunion social on Friday evening at the Lake Havasu Museum of History’s Mind of McCulloch Exhibit at the London Bridge Beach.

    VIP Viewing Area- Get the best seats in the house within the VIP Viewing Area. Located at the Lakeside Terrace adjacent to the Turtle Grille at the Nautical Beachfront Resort, the VIP viewing area is situated between the official judges stand and turn one under 500 feet from the racing action.

    Friday Night Beach Party presented by Kicker Marine Audio- From 4-8 pm at the London Bridge Beach. This gives everyone time to spend with the drivers and crews to learn more about them and the equipment they race. Autographs, pictures, along with fan appreciation memorabilia assures everyone will leave with a smile on their face. Vintage boat display.

    Mind of McCulloch Exhibit- Presented by the Lake Havasu Museum of History, this special exhibition features historical artifacts from the city of Lake Havasu, the McCulloch family, and McCulloch Engineered Products. Beyond the exhibition is the Kids’ Activity Zone, Race Viewing Area, Vendors, Food and Beer Garden. Friday 4-8pm, Saturday and Sunday 10am-5pm. This special event will be free and open to the public.

    Vintage Boat Display- Fans and racers alike will have the unique opportunity to view powerboat racings historically significant boats on display during the Friday Night Beach Party. The combination of these boats and the men who drove them will make for an entertaining family fun evening. Shifting the vintage boat’s location to the racing headquarters at the Nautical Beachfront Resort for both Saturday and Sunday’s racing action will allow additional viewing of these classics for all.
